Posted on 5/28/16 at 9:58 am to FlyingTiger06
quote:
If they are going to break out the MC-130H and the MC-130J as different, they missed the MC-130W Dragon Spear.
The MC-130H and MC-130J are significantly different. The MC-130W is no more, it's now renamed the AC-130W.
Looks like they omitted the Marine KC-130J. It can shoot back now too.
